CP-violation parameters from decay rates ofB±→DK±,D→multibodyfinal states
2009
We describe a method for measuring CP-violation parameters from which the Cabibbo-Kobayashi-Maskawa angle $\gamma$ may be extracted. The method makes use of the total decay rates in $B^\pm \to DK^\pm$ decays, where the neutral $D$ meson decays to multibody final states. We analyze the error of the method using experimental CP-violation analysis variables that enable straightforward sensitivity comparison with other methods for extracting $\gamma$, and discuss the use of $B$-factory and charm-factory data to obtain the relevant charm decay information needed for this measurement. Measurement sensitivities are estimated for the currently available $B$-factory data sample, and $D$ decay modes for which use of this method can make a significant contribution toward reducing the total error on $\gamma$ are identified.
